Q: Is 825,080 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 825,080 is not a prime number.

Why is 825,080 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 825080 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 20 40 20,627 41,254 82,508 103,135 165,016 206,270 412,540 and 825,080, with no remainder.

Since 825,080 cannot be divided by just 1 and 825,080, it is not a prime number.
